Make your account more secure
- Protect your information by creating a stronger password. Use a different password for each website and create one just for your Xfinity account.
- Turn on Two-step Verification for added security when you sign in. It helps protect your account, Xfinity web pages, and most Xfinity apps by requiring a verification code along with your Xfinity ID and password.

Password recovery
You need to have a verified personal (non-Xfinity) email address or mobile number on your Xfinity account. This helps you reset your password if needed.
